【问题标题】:Stringify Mongoose ObjectId schema field on Query查询上的字符串化 Mongoose ObjectId 模式字段
【发布时间】:2015-05-26 06:23:00
【问题描述】:

是否可以通过 Mongoose Schema 对声明为 ObjectId 类型的集合中的字段进行字符串化?我希望 .lean() 能做到这一点,但似乎我仍在找回 ObjectId。我想我想要的是查询返回到 JSON 转换。这在单个 Mongoose 查询中可行吗?如果没有,我将如何手动转换嵌套文档中的所有 ObjectId 类型?

【问题讨论】:

    标签: mongoose objectid


    【解决方案1】:

    我不知道你是否还有这个问题,虽然我找到了你的问题,因为我遇到了同样的问题。

    这是我根据 mongodb 文档找到的内容:

    ObjectId("hexID").valueOf() 将返回一个十六进制 ID 的字符串。

    【讨论】:

    • 该问题与 Mongoose Query 类有关。
    猜你喜欢
    • 2015-01-17
    • 2020-07-15
    • 1970-01-01
    • 1970-01-01
    • 2017-11-05
    • 2015-06-08
    • 2018-06-04
    • 1970-01-01
    • 1970-01-01
    相关资源
    最近更新 更多